What Is the Orgasm Face?

The term “orgasm face” refers to the intense facial expressions that often accompany an orgasm. These can include a variety of contorted expressions such as squinted eyes, open mouths, and tensed facial muscles. The face may display signs of strain, relaxation, or sheer pleasure during the peak of sexual arousal.
This unique expression is often involuntary and happens as part of the physical and emotional climax. It’s a visible cue of sexual release, often linked to the sensations felt in the genital area, but it also involves the muscles of the face. These involuntary expressions are often associated with the emotional intensity that accompanies sexual release, signaling that something deeply pleasurable is happening in the body.

Why Does the Orgasm Face Happen?
The orgasm face happens because of a complex interplay between the brain and the muscles of the face. When a person reaches orgasm, the brain releases a rush of neurotransmitters like dopamine and oxytocin, which contribute to feelings of pleasure and satisfaction. This rush of neurotransmitters also affects the muscles, not just in the genitals, but throughout the body—including the face.
Facial expressions during orgasm are driven by the activation of the sympathetic nervous system. This system is responsible for the “fight or flight” response, which prepares the body for intense physical exertion. During orgasm, this system goes into overdrive, leading to muscle contractions throughout the body, including those in the face. The muscles in the eyes, jaw, and mouth tense, which results in what we recognize as the orgasm face.

The Science Behind Facial Expressions During Orgasm

Understanding the science behind the orgasm face requires exploring the neurological and physiological processes that occur during orgasm. Orgasm involves a release of tension in the body, accompanied by a cascade of physical reactions, such as increased heart rate, muscle contractions, and changes in breathing.
One of the key players in the face’s reaction is the autonomic nervous system. This system controls involuntary bodily functions, including the facial muscles. The involuntary muscle contractions during orgasm often manifest in the face, causing people to make expressions that signal both pleasure and exertion. These facial muscles are controlled by the same brain regions involved in emotional expression, further linking the orgasm face to emotional satisfaction.

What the Orgasm Face Reveals About Sexual Satisfaction
The orgasm face can be more than just an involuntary physical reaction; it can also offer insight into the level of sexual satisfaction a person is experiencing. Many people report that the intensity of their orgasm face correlates directly with the intensity of their orgasm. For instance, the more ecstatic or intense the orgasm, the more exaggerated the facial expressions may become.
Additionally, these expressions can reveal how in tune a person is with their body’s sexual responses. Partners can often read these facial cues to gauge their lover's pleasure, creating a more communicative and intimate experience. The orgasm face, in many ways, acts as an emotional release—a way for individuals to express their most primal feelings of sexual pleasure, even when words fail.

Cultural Perceptions and Media Representation of the Orgasm Face
While the orgasm face is natural, its portrayal in popular culture often adds an element of fantasy or exaggeration. Movies and TV shows tend to amplify facial expressions during sex, sometimes for comedic effect or to heighten the drama of a scene. These exaggerated portrayals create unrealistic expectations for how people should look during orgasm.
However, the real-life orgasm face can be far more varied. Everyone’s experience of orgasm—and the way it manifests physically—is unique. In reality, the orgasm face might not always match the exaggerated portrayals seen on screen. Nonetheless, this portrayal plays a role in shaping societal perceptions of sex, orgasm, and the “right” way to express pleasure.
Can You Control the Orgasm Face?

Some may wonder whether it's possible to control the orgasm face. For those who may feel self-conscious about their facial expressions during sex, it's natural to ask if these reactions can be suppressed or altered. While it is possible to intentionally hold back certain expressions, the facial muscles involved during orgasm often react involuntarily. This means that complete control over the orgasm face can be difficult to achieve.
That said, becoming more in tune with one’s body and sexual response can provide a better sense of awareness. Some people can modify their facial expressions to some extent by focusing on relaxing certain facial muscles during orgasm. However, it’s important to embrace these natural reactions and allow the body to express pleasure freely.
